What You Should Know About The Wildhearts

The Wildhearts formed in 1989 after Ginger was dismissed from the English hard rock band the Quireboys. According to The Wildhearts’ bio, Ginger was “kicked out for doing too many drugs.” He also had a brief stint as a member of Faces.

The Wildhearts scored multiple top 10 singles over the years. Their debut album, Earth vs. the Wildhearts, was named the best album of 1993 by Kerrang!

The band’s most recent album, Satanic Rites of the Wildhearts, was released in 2025. It also marked the band’s first effort following a brief three-year hiatus.
